When an already-defined variable is given the same name within a new object, object-shorthand syntax is preferred as being more compact. Similarly, object-shorthand is also preferred for the definition of functions in object literals.
== Noncompliant Code Example
----
let a = 1;
let myObj = {
a : a, // Noncompliant
fun: function () { // Noncompliant
//...
}
== Compliant Solution
a,
fun () {
